📋 Description

• Support the Project Manager with ongoing modifications, challenges, and project requirements throughout the project lifecycle, ensuring alignment on timelines, scope, and project hurdles.

• Work in conjunction with the Project Manager and the Superintendent to uphold the project schedule, including both the overall timeline and the three-week schedule on a weekly basis.

• Facilitate the transition between estimating and construction by validating IFC (Issued for Construction) plans, quantities, and assumptions, which includes processing contract true-ups based on IFC drawings and field conditions.

• Assist with the preparation, tracking, and reconciliation of change orders and contract true-ups throughout the project duration.

• Oversee the Submittal Process – gather, prepare, submit, track, and ensure timely approvals.

• Manage the RFI Process – collaborate with the Project Manager to prepare and submit RFIs, track, and ensure timely closure.

• Aid in material sourcing and procurement in coordination with the Project Manager and Estimator.

• Support One-Call updates and dig permit coordination to ensure safe field operations.

• Manage GPS topographic surveys, including pre-construction, progress, and as-built surveys.

• Compare GPS models (provided vs. actuals) to calculate and verify quantities.

• Compile survey data and convert it into actionable information for project tracking and verification.

• Maintain an FAA Part 107 Drone License and conduct UAV operations as necessary.

• Assist with layout, surveying, and quantity take-offs for materials.

• Keep project logs updated, including Quantity tracker, Submittal logs, RFI logs, etc.

• Support progress meetings by preparing agendas, meeting minutes, and follow-up action items.


⛳️ Requirements

• 1–3 years of experience in civil construction (internship experience may be considered).

• Strong understanding of civil construction methods, materials, and standards.

• Proficiency in Magnet/Topcon Office and construction management software is preferred but not mandatory (Procore, Acumatica, Primavera P6, MS Project, Microsoft 365, or similar).

• FAA Part 107 Drone License (required or the ability to obtain within 6 months).

•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ational abilities.

• Capability to read and interpret construction drawings and specifications.

• Must be available for full-time travel.
